Graduate Partner Marketing Manager
Canonical is a leading provider of open source software and operating systems, known for its platform Ubuntu. They are seeking a Graduate Partner Marketing Manager to help cultivate and expand strategic relationships with major tech companies, supporting joint marketing activities and partner program development.
Computer Software
Responsibilities
Support Partner Strategy: Assist in building joint go-to-market plans with global partners, helping to refine messaging and track pipeline generation
Campaign Execution: Help create and deliver integrated campaigns, including product launches, webinar series, and industry announcements in collaboration with partner teams
Creative Packaging: Learn to package Canonical's diverse product offerings, from AI and Kubernetes to bare metal, into educational and engaging marketing materials
Ecosystem Growth: Contribute to the growth of Canonical's partner network by delivering high-quality support and value to our partners
Program Scaling: Help develop and streamline partner activities, using automation and feedback to help our partner programs scale globally
Cross-functional Learning: Work closely with internal alliances, product and sales teams to ensure partner marketing efforts align with broader company goals
